Soon after moving to St. Mary’s County, MD with her husband, they cofounded the St. Mary’s County Camera Club in 1998 in an effort to promote the art of photography as a hobby. She has won many Camera Club awards and Grand Champion ribbons at the St. Mary’s County Fair. She has photographed event, travel, animal and nature photography for many years. Most recently, she has enjoyed being the Official Volunteer Photographer for the Chesapeake Orchestra River Concert Series. She previously volunteered photographic River Concert reviews for the Baynet. She has been one of the judges for the St. Mary's County Fair photography competitions many times. Her photographic style is generally colorful, with a strong simplified subject and an awareness of line and shape. She loves catching reflections, beautiful light, movement and emotions whenever possible. Her photos have been on display at the Annmarie Garden, Lexington Park and Leonardtown Libraries, So Branch Calvert Library and more.
